, преподаватель, кафедра информатики и информационных технологий ДВГГУ
html: РАБОТА С БАЗАМИ ДАННЫХ В ПРИМЕРАХ
Пояснительная записка...................................................................................................................................................................... 1
Тематическое планирование............................................................................................................................................................ 2
Текст пособия....................................................................................................................................................................................... 3
Базы данных........................................................................................................................................................................................ 3
Назначение и функциональные возможности языка разметки гипертекста (HTML)........................................... 3
Основы Visual Basic Script (VBScript)......................................................................................................................................... 7
Основы создания сценариев на Visual Basic Script............................................................................................................... 9
Проектирование баз данных с помощью HTML................................................................................................................ 12
Пояснительная записка
В настоящее время информацию рассматривают как один из основных ресурсов развития общества, а информационные системы и технологии как средство повышения производительности и эффективности работы людей.
Информационные системы и базы данных стали неотъемлемой частью нашей повседневной жизни: покупка в супермаркете, расчеты с использованием кредитной карты, работа в Internet, обучение в университете и пр. Большинство отраслей человеческой деятельности связано с внедрением и использованием баз данных, которые обеспечивают хранение информации, представление данных для пользователей, что повышает эффективность работы. Наиболее широко информационные системы и базы данных используются в производственной, управленческой и финансовой деятельности.
Язык разметки гипертекста (HTML) позволяет быстро и эффективно разрабатывать самые разнообразные приложения, включая и приложения для работы с базами данных.
Цель предлагаемой программы: познакомить слушателей с основными понятиями, связанными с проектированием баз данных, с процессом создания приложений для них с помощью HTML, который поддерживает язык программирования VBScript для разработки запросов, организации взаимодействия внешних данных с базой данных в HTML.
Задачи программы:
1) Рассмотреть основной понятийный аппарат реляционных баз данных.
2) Научить проектировать реляционные базы данных и приложения.
3) Показать технологию создания информационных систем.
4) Познакомить слушателей с основными элементами языка HTML и языка программирования VBScript для работы с базами данных.
5) Показать возможность применения языка разметки гипертекста (HTML) для быстрой разработки приложений при работе с базами данных.
Требования к уровню усвоения содержания курса
В результате освоения программы курса слушатели должны:
· формулировать основные понятия, связанные с базами данных: информационная систем, база данных;
· перечислять основные объекты базы данных и определять их назначение;
· формулировать основные понятия реляционных баз данных: отношение, атрибут, запись, ключи и индексы;
· распознавать подходы к проектированию баз данных;
· выделять основные элементы языка разметки гипертекста (HTML) для работы с базами данных;
· перечислять компоненты, основные функции языка программирования VBScript для доступа к данным и для работы с ними (отбор данных из таблиц);
· определять характеристику проекта в HTML (состав проекта, файл проекта, файлы формы, файл ресурсов, параметры проекта).
В процессе изучения курса слушатели должны приобрести умения:
· создавать локальные базы данных с помощью HTML, приложения в HTML, позволяющие просматривать записи, перемещаться по записям, выполнять поиск;
· использовать в приложениях язык программирования VBScript;
· создавать связи между таблицами реляционной базы данных посредством гиперссылок.
Программа рассчитана на слушателей, которые работают на компьютере в той или иной области и имеют представление об основных компонентах и функциях какого-либо из языков программирования.
Тематическое планирование
№ | Тема | Лек. | Л/з |
1. 1. | Базы данных реляционного типа. Основные понятия и определения. Разработка баз данных: общие подходы. | 2 | |
2. 2. | Язык разметки гипертекста HTML для работы с базами данных. структура HTML-документа; VBScript как язык программирования, поддерживаемый HTML; основные операторы языка VBScript. | 2 | 2 |
3. 3. | Проектирование баз данных: создание баз данных средствами HTML; создание таблиц; связь внешних данных (текстовые документы, рисунки, фотографии, музыкальные фрагменты) с HTML-документами. | 2 | 2 |
4. 4. | Создание приложений для работы с базами данных: создание форм с перемещением по записям базы данных; индексирование таблиц; сортировка данных таблицы по различным полям. | 2 | 3 |
5. 5 5. | Проектирование запросов на поиск информации в базе данных. Формулировка и реализация запросов на языке программирования VBScript. Создание связи между таблицами реляционной базы данных посредством гиперссылок. | 2 | 3 |
Итого | 10 | 10 |
Текст пособия
Базы данных
С точки зрения пользователя, база данных – это программа, которая обеспечивает работу с информацией. При запуске такой программы на экране появляется таблица, просматривая которую пользователь может найти интересующие его сведения. Если система позволяет, то он может внести изменения в базу данных: добавить новую информацию или удалить ненужную.
С точки зрения программиста, база данных – это набор файлов, содержащих информацию. Разрабатывая базу данных для пользователя, программист создает программу, которая обеспечивает работу с файлами данных.
В настоящее время существует достаточно большое количество программных сред, позволяющих создавать и использовать базы данных.
Назначение и функциональные возможности языка разметки гипертекста (HTML)
Для создания базы данных, отображаемой браузером Internet Explorer (программа для просмотра HTML-документов), разработан специальный язык HTML (Hyper Text Markup Language) – язык разметки гипертекста.
HTML-документ содержит набор управляющих последовательностей, определяющих действия, которые браузер выполняет при загрузке документа.
Каждый документ представляет собой текстовый файл и содержит текст (изображения), который пользователи баз данных видят, и некоторые инструкции для программы просмотра, не отображаемые на экране. Эти инструкции условно можно разделить на два типа:
· описание внешнего вида документа (размер букв, тип шрифта, элементы оформления),
· ссылки на другие ресурсы, которые делают из текста гипертекст.
Гипертекст – способ организации текстовой информации, внутри которой установлены смысловые связи между ее различными фрагментами (гиперсвязи).
Структура HTML-документа
В основе любого HTML-документа лежит понятие тега (tag).
Тег – это начальный или конечный маркер элемента. Теги определяют границы действия элементов и отделяют элементы друг от друга.
В тексте HTML-документа теги заключаются в угловые скобки: <тег>. Теги используются для разметки документа, форматирования текста и ряда других функций, но никогда не выводятся браузером на экран. Обычно теги представляют собой пары. В этом случае различают открывающий и закрывающий теги, между которыми может располагаться любой текст, в том числе и любое количество вложенных тегов. Завершающий тег отличается от открывающего наличием слэша (/) перед именем тега:
<тег> текст </тег>.
Структура любого HTML-документа выглядит следующим образом:
<HTML>
<HEAD>
<TITLE> заголовок и описание документа </TITLE>
</HEAD>
<BODY>
Хабаровская краевая летняя физико-математическая школа
</BODY>
</HTML>
<HTML> </HTML>
Начинает и заканчивает любой HTML-документ.
<HEAD> </HEAD>
Область заголовка HTML-документа, служит для формирования структуры документа. Этот элемент включает TITLE и допускает вложение элементов SCRIPT, STYLE.
<TITLE> </TITLE>
Элемент для размещения заголовка в окне браузера.
<BODY> </BODY>
Этот элемент заключает в себе гипертекст, который определяет HTML-документ. Внутри элемента BODY можно использовать все элементы, предназначенные для форматирования HTML-документа. Внутри начального тега элемента BODY можно расположить ряд атрибутов (свойств).
Рассмотрим некоторые из них:
· Установка «обоев»: <body background=”путь к файлу обоев”>,
· Установка цвета фона: <body bgcolor=”цвет”>,
· Установка цвета выводимых символов: <body text=”цвет”>.
Пример: <body bgcolor=”red” text=”yellow”>ТЕКСТ</body>. Данный пример показывает, что в основной области HTML-документа будет располагаться слово ТЕКСТ на красном фоне желтыми буквами.
|
Из за большого объема этот материал размещен на нескольких страницах:
1 2 3 4 5 6 |


